On August 30, 2025, a shocking video out of Hersheypark in Pennsylvania stunned everyone. This video in question showed a young boy walking dangerously along the park’s monorail track high above the ground. The clip, which spread across social media platforms and news sites, left millions of viewers with the same burning question: “How did the boy even get up there?”

What Happened in the Hersheypark Monorail Video?

The video shows a boy casually walking along the narrow monorail beam while a crowd below looks on in shock. According to witnesses, a bystander eventually climbed up and safely retrieved the boy, bringing huge relief to the screaming onlookers.

Hersheypark themselves later confirmed that the boy was unharmed and reunited with his family.

What Actually Happened, According to Hersheypark

Hersheypark later explained that the boy had first been reported missing after getting separated from his parents. While park staff were actively searching for him, he somehow managed to slip into a secured area for the Monorail, which was not in operation at the time. That is when he was spotted walking along the track, high above the crowd below.

This honestly clears up a lot of the speculation that spread online. The child wasn’t just wandering freely into a dangerous area by chance. The truth is that he had been reported missing, and in the chaos of the search, he found his way into the Monorail section.

Can the Family Sue Hersheypark?

In theory, yes, the family could sue Hersheypark if they believe negligence played a role. Theme parks have a legal duty of care to keep guests safe, and that includes making sure restricted areas and closed rides are properly secured. If it turns out the boy was able to step onto the monorail track because gates or barriers weren’t locked or guarded, the park could be held partly responsible.

That said, lawsuits like this aren’t always straightforward. Hersheypark might argue that the parents were responsible for supervising their child and that the park took reasonable steps to secure the ride while it was closed. In the end, I think much would depend on witness statements, video evidence, and whether safety protocols were followed that day.

Often in cases like this, families and theme parks settle quietly out of court to avoid bad publicity. But even if no lawsuit is filed, the incident is likely to push Hersheypark to review its safety procedures and tighten up how closed rides are monitored.
